If you're in the market for an SUV that's capable of off-roading but also want to hold up to eight occupants, then a used Land Rover Defender 130 is a great choice.
Quickly becoming one of the UK's most popular three-row SUVs, the Land Rover Defender 130 offers spacious seating and plenty of capability to handle the roads less travelled. Standard with all Defender 130 models is some of the technology and equipment that's optional with the two-row variants.
The Defender 130 comes with the option of two inline-six engines, both featuring mild-hybrid technology and a supercharger, or a V8 variant. With the combination of the body-on-frame configuration, fully independent suspension, standard 4x4 and 11.5 inches of ground clearance, it's a large, capable SUV.
The Land Rover Defender 130 is designed to fit large families without giving up the features that matter across the long haul.
The new Defender 130 starts at around £70,000+ as a new car. If you find a used Defender 130 for sale, you may be able to either get one for a lower price or find one with more optional features for less than a brand new SUV.
The Land Rover Defender 130 earns a rating of 31.3 mpg combined, which is reasonable for the size of vehicle and its performance level.
Land Rover only produces so many Defender models each year, making them more valuable. The off-road capability, reliable build and high-tech interior also contribute to the higher price tag.
While the Defender refers to several different variants made by Land Rover, the number following the name refers to the inches of the wheelbase length. Therefore, a Defender 90 features a wheelbase measuring 93 inches, the Defender 110 has a 119-inch wheelbase and the Defender 130's wheelbase measures the same, but the length is 13.4 inches longer than the 110.
If you want to take a trip and explore the wilderness, the Defender 130 Outbound model may be your best option. It provides additional space for sleeping or resting, without giving up the cargo capacity needed to take your gear along.
Yes, there's an optional V8 engine available that outputs 500 horsepower. The Defender 130 also offers an inline-six engine with mild-hybrid technology. Both engines pair with standard four-wheel drive for maximum capability.
Land Rover is considered a reliable automaker, ensuring that the Defender engines are meant to go many miles without any problems. To reach 200,000 miles in a Defender, it's best to follow all of the recommended maintenance and specified intervals.
